Trust Wallet(トラストウォレット)のトークン送金後に着金しない時の確認ポイント
近年、暗号資産(仮想通貨)の利用が急速に拡大しており、多くのユーザーがモバイルウォレットを通じて資産を管理するようになっています。その中でも、Trust Walletは、シンプルな操作性と高いセキュリティを備えた人気のあるデジタルウォレットとして広く知られています。しかし、ユーザーの中には「送金したトークンがまだ着金していない」「宛先アドレスに到着していない」というトラブルに直面することがあります。このような状況では、焦りや不安が生じる一方で、正確な原因の特定と適切な対処が重要です。
本記事では、Trust Walletでトークンを送金した後に着金しない場合にチェックすべきポイントを、専門的な視点から詳細に解説します。特に、ブロックチェーン上のトランザクションの仕組み、ウォレットの設定、ネットワークの遅延など、技術的な側面を踏まえながら、実際のトラブルシューティング手順を紹介します。正しい知識を持つことで、問題解決のスピードが格段に向上します。
1. 送金トランザクションの確認:ブロックチェーン上での状態をチェックする
まず最初に行うべきことは、送金されたトランザクションが実際にブロックチェーン上に記録されているかどうかを確認することです。Trust Wallet自体は送信された情報を外部のブロックチェーンに転送するだけであり、送金の成功・失敗はネットワークの状況によって決まります。
以下のステップでトランザクションの状態を確認できます:
- Transaction ID(TXID)の確認:送金完了後、Trust Walletの取引履歴画面に表示される「Tx Hash」または「Transaction ID」をコピーします。
- ブロックチェーンエクスプローラーの利用:Copied TXIDを、対応するブロックチェーンの公式エクスプローラーに貼り付けます。たとえば、Ethereum(ETH)の場合には Etherscan、Binance Smart Chain(BNB)なら BscScan を使用します。
- トランザクションのステータス:エクスプローラー上で「Pending(保留中)」「Success(成功)」「Failed(失敗)」などのステータスが表示されます。ここでは「Success」が正しく、送金が承認された証拠となります。
もし「Pending」のまま長時間放置されている場合は、ネットワークの混雑や手数料不足が原因である可能性があります。逆に「Failed」であれば、送金自体が失敗しているため、再送金が必要になります。
2. ネットワークの選択ミス:誤ったチェーンを選んでいないか
非常に重要なポイントとして、「送金時に誤ったブロックチェーンネットワークを選択した」ことが原因で着金しないケースが頻発しています。たとえば、Ethereumネットワークで送金したつもりが、BSC(Binance Smart Chain)ネットワークを選んでしまった場合、送金されたトークンは目的のアドレスに届きません。
この現象は「トークンが消失した」と錯覚させる原因となるため、特に注意が必要です。以下のような事例が典型的です:
- ETHを送金しようとしたが、BSCネットワークを選択して送金 → 送金先アドレスに「BEP-20トークン」が着金し、ETHはどこにもない。
- USDT(Tether)を送金する際、ERC-20ではなくBEPS-20を選択 → 受信側が該当ネットワークに対応していない場合、受け取り不可。
解決策としては、送金前に「ネットワークの種類」を必ず確認してください。Trust Walletでは、各トークンの送金画面で「Network」のプルダウンメニューがあり、対応するネットワークを選択可能です。送金前には「どのネットワークで送金するのか?」を明確にし、受信側のウォレットがそのネットワークに対応しているかも確認しましょう。
3. トークンのタイプとネットワークの整合性
同一名称のトークンでも、異なるブロックチェーン上では別々のアセットとして存在します。たとえば、「USDT」は以下のネットワークで異なる形式で存在します:
- ERC-20(Ethereum)
- BEP-20(Binance Smart Chain)
- TRC-20(Tron)
これらのトークンは名前は同じですが、互換性がなく、一方のネットワークで送金したトークンを他方のネットワークに受け取ることはできません。そのため、送金する際には「送信元」と「受信先」の両方で同じネットワークを使用しているかを厳密に確認する必要があります。
また、一部のウォレット(特に海外の取引所)では、特定のネットワークのみをサポートしている場合があります。受信側のウォレットが「BEP-20 USDT」を受け入れられるか、事前に確認しておくことが不可欠です。
4. 手数料の不足によるトランザクション拒否
ブロックチェーン上でのトランザクションは、手数料(Gas Fee)によって処理されます。手数料が不足していると、ネットワークはトランザクションを無視したり、保留状態に置いたりします。これにより、送金が「着金しない」ように見えるのです。
Trust Walletでは、手数料の見積もり機能を搭載していますが、ネットワークの混雑状況によっては、予測よりも高額な手数料が必要になることがあります。特に、Ethereumネットワークはトランザクションの競合が激しいため、手数料が低すぎると、処理が遅れたり、完全に無効化されたりするリスクがあります。
対処法:
- 手数料を「High」または「Custom」モードに設定し、より高いガス料金を支払う。
- ネットワークの混雑状況を事前に確認(例:Etherscanの「Gas Tracker」)。
- 手数料が足りていない場合、トランザクションが「Failed」になる可能性があるため、再送金の準備をしておく。
5. 受信アドレスの誤り:正しいアドレスに送金されているか
最も基本的だが、最も深刻なミスの一つが「受信アドレスの誤入力」です。数字や文字の1文字違いでも、アドレスは全く異なるものとなり、送金先のウォレットに到着しません。
特に、アルファベットの大文字と小文字の区別(例:B、b)や、数字の0(ゼロ)とO(オー)の混同など、視認性の低い文字は誤入力の原因になりやすいです。また、QRコードからの読み取りミスも報告されています。
対策として:
- 受信アドレスは2回以上確認する。
- アドレスの末尾や先頭部分を特に注目し、一致しているかチェック。
- QRコードは、カメラのズームや明るさを調整して正確に読み取る。
- 受信者に「アドレスを確認したか」をメールやチャットで確認する。
誤って送られた場合、ほとんどのブロックチェーンでは送金の取り消しは不可能です。そのため、送金前にアドレスの正確性を最優先で確認することが必須です。
6. ウォレットの同期状態とデータ更新
Trust Walletが最新のブロックチェーンデータに同期していない場合、送金済みのトークンが「未着」と表示されることがあります。これは、アプリ内のキャッシュ情報と実際のブロックチェーン状況にずれが生じているためです。
この問題を解決するには、以下の操作を行います:
- Trust Walletアプリを一度終了し、再起動する。
- ウォレットの画面から「Refresh(更新)」ボタンを押す。
- インターネット接続を確認し、安定した環境で再試行。
- アプリを最新バージョンにアップデートする。
多くの場合、これらの操作で即座に着金したトークンが表示されます。アプリの同期が遅れているだけの場合、手数料の高い再送金は不要です。
7. 過去の送金履歴の確認とエラー記録
送金後に着金しない場合、過去の送金履歴を確認することで、問題のパターンを見つけることができます。例えば、複数回同じアドレスに送金しても着金しない場合、受信側のウォレットが一時的に障害を起こしている可能性があります。
また、送金履歴に「Pending」が長期間続く場合は、ネットワークの問題や、受信側のウォレットが処理できない設定になっている可能性があります。このような場合には、送金元のアドレスと受信先のアドレスをそれぞれブロックチェーンエクスプローラーで調査し、異常がないかを検証します。
必要に応じて、送金元のウォレット管理者や受信先のサポートチームに連絡し、状況を共有することも有効です。
8. 受信側のウォレット設定の確認
送金は成功しても、受信側のウォレットがそのトークンを認識していない場合、着金していないと表示されます。特に、カスタムトークンや新規登録されたトークンを受信する場合、ウォレットにそのトークンの情報が登録されていないと、自動的に表示されません。
対処方法:
- 受信側のウォレットで「Custom Token(カスタムトークン)」を追加する。
- トークンのコントラクトアドレス(Contract Address)とシンボル(Symbol)を正確に入力。
- ネットワークが一致しているかを再度確認。
たとえば、BSC上の新しいプロジェクトトークンを受信する場合、Trust Walletにそのトークンを手動で追加しないと、残高欄に表示されません。この点を忘れないようにしましょう。
9. トラブルシューティングのまとめ:ステップバイステップガイド
以上の内容を踏まえて、送金後に着金しない場合の対処手順をまとめます:
- 送金後のトランザクションのステータスをブロックチェーンエクスプローラーで確認(TXIDで検索)。
- ネットワークの選択が正しいか、送信元と受信先のネットワークが一致しているかを確認。
- 受信アドレスが正確に記述されているか、2回以上確認。
- 手数料が十分に設定されているか、ネットワークの混雑状況を確認。
- Trust Walletアプリを再起動し、ウォレットを更新(Refresh)。
- 受信側のウォレットで、該当トークンがカスタムトークンとして追加されているか確認。
- 受信側のウォレットが正常に動作しているか、他のユーザーからの問い合わせを参考にする。
- 問題が解決しない場合は、送金元・受信元のサポート窓口に連絡。
10. 結論:予防と知識がトラブル回避の鍵
Trust Walletでトークン送金後に着金しないという問題は、技術的な知識と注意深い操作がなければ発生しやすいものです。しかし、本記事で紹介した確認ポイントを逐一チェックすることで、多くの問題は早期に解決可能となります。
特に、ネットワークの選択ミスや受信アドレスの誤入力、手数料不足といった課題は、初心者ユーザーにとって大きな落とし穴です。これらを避けるためには、送金前の「確認プロセス」を習慣化することが何より重要です。
また、ブロックチェーン技術は非中央集権的かつ不可逆的な特性を持つため、送金の取り消しは原則として不可能です。そのため、送金前に慎重に行動し、万が一のトラブルに備える準備が求められます。
最後に、信頼できる情報源や公式ドキュメントを活用し、常に最新の知識を身につける姿勢を持つことが、安全な暗号資産運用の基盤となります。本記事が、ユーザー皆様の安心なウォレット利用の一助となれば幸いです。
※ 注意事項:本記事は一般的なトラブルシューティングの指針を示すものであり、個別の事例に対する保証や責任を負うものではありません。あくまで自己責任のもと、ご判断ください。